Month 1 (Days 1–30)
  • Monday: Send Loom scorecard
  • Include: targets vs. actuals, top constraint, next 3 actions
  • Wednesday: Send voice note mid-week check-in
  • Flag any early wins or blockers; keep under 90 seconds
  • Friday: Send Loom recap
  • Cover: week's performance, one constraint identified, roadmap for next week

Month 2 (Days 31–60)
  • Highlight one specific, named result (e.g., "14 leads at $38 CPL vs. $60 target")
  • Frame it as proof of momentum, not a report
  • What's being tested, what's being scaled, what the client can expect
  • Timing: 3 days before billing date
  • Include one concrete metric that improved
